JOB TITLE: Human Resources Generalist
REPORTS TO: Human Resources Director
SUPERVISES: N/A
DEPARTMENT: Human Resources
JOB STATUS: Full-Time, 12-Month Position
FLSA STATUS: Non-Exempt
PAY RATE: $50,000.00 - $70,000.00 Annual Salary
Job SummaryThe Human Resources Generalist executes the daily operational and administrative functions of the Human Resources (HR) department for the District's certified and non-certified staff. This role ensures compliance with the Illinois School Code and state and federal labor laws while managing complex cycles of recruitment, retention, terminations, and District-wide systems maintenance. Given the regulatory nature of this role, a high level of attention to detail and accuracy is a core expectation for all job functions.
CoreResponsibilities
- Front-Facing Support:
Welcomes and directs visitors and staff; manages departmental phone inquiries and scheduling. - Full-Cycle Recruitment:
Manages vacancy postings, applicant screening, and interview coordination. - Background Screening:
Administers the mandated Employment History Review (EHR) process, fingerprint-based background checks, and ISBE sexual misconduct disclosures. - Onboarding & Induction:
Supports comprehensive new hire orientations and ensures all legal, medical, and District-specific paperwork is completed. - Student Teacher Placements:
Coordinates with universities for student teacher intake and ensures all background clearances are verified. - Pension Administration:
Facilitates accurate enrollment and reporting for the Teachers' Retirement System (TRS) and the Illinois Municipal Retirement Fund (IMRF). - Health & Welfare Administration:
Supports benefits enrollment (Medical, Dental, Vision), open enrollment cycles, and qualifying life event changes. Collaborates with the Business Office on benefits deduction updates. - Leave Compliance:
Administers all leave requests using specialized compliance tools and logs absences. Collaborates with the Business Office on compensation and benefit continuations. - Retirement Lifecycle Support:
Processes retirement agreements and collaborates with the Business Office on retirement compensation benefits. - Offboarding:
Supports the separation process, including asset retrieval (badges/keys) and COBRA notifications. Collaborates with the Business Office on final compensation. - HRIS & Student Data Management:
Maintains high-level data integrity within Employee Information Systems (Infinite Visions, Frontline, Evalu Wise, etc.) and Student Information Systems (Infinite Campus). Oversees the annual systems "rollover" (PTO resets, extra-duty auditing, etc.). - State & Federal Reporting:
Prepares mandated state data (EIS, IWAS surveys, EEO-5) and corrects data via the ISBE Data Quality Dashboard. - Training & Evaluation Compliance:
Tracks completion of state-mandated trainings and maintains the staff evaluation platform. - Team Building & Staff Appreciation:
Provides support for District-wide team-building activities, recognition programs, and large-scale staff events. - Union Liaison:
Supports the HR Director in communications with three bargaining units and maintains/updates official seniority lists. - Position Control:
Monitors the District's position controls to ensure all hires and transfers align with approved staffing levels. - File & Risk Governance:
Maintains and audits personnel and medical files (HIPAA/FMLA/ADA compliance); facilitates Workers' Compensation intake and OSHA log maintenance. - Unemployment Management:
Monitors and responds to IDES unemployment claims and fact-finding inquiries. - Fiscal Administration:
Processes department purchase orders and requisitions, ensuring proper coding and approvals for supplies and services. - Information Management:
Collects and synthesizes data from various sources to prepare summaries, research findings, and reports for projects or inquiries. - Professional Development:
Participates in professional development opportunities as necessary. - Attendance:
Attends work as scheduled and arrives in a timely manner. - Performs other related duties as assigned.
